E1 Corporation (017940) has an Asset Resilience Ratio of 37.34% as of December 2025. The Asset Resilience Ratio measures the percentage of a company's total assets that are held in liquid form (cash and short-term investments). This metric indicates how well-positioned the company is to handle unexpected financial challenges, economic downturns, or strategic opportunities without requiring external financing. About

E1 Corporation imports, stores, trades, and sells liquefied petroleum gas (LPG) in South Korea. The company transports LPG from oil-producing countries; and stores and manages LPG at Yeosu, Daesan, and Incheon terminals.
